Xpath路径

XPath 语言使用路径表达式来选取 XML 文档中的节点或节点集。节点是沿着路径 (path) 或者步 (steps) 来选取的。

 

1、节点类型

根节点(文档节点)

元素节点

属性节点

文本节点

注释节点

命名空间

处理指令

 

2、节点之间的关系

子节点

父节点

同胞节点

先辈节点

后代节点

 

3、Xpath路径表达     

 1、Xpath绝对路径:/step/step/...
2、Xpath相对路径:step/step/...

step格式: 轴名称::节点测试[谓语]


轴(axis): 定义所选节点与当前节点之间的树关系

  

     

  节点测试(node-test) :识别某个轴内部的节点

  谓语(predicate) :用来查找某个特定的节点或者包含某个指定的值的节点。谓语被嵌在方括号中。可以用1个多个谓语

  

  路径示例:

      

 

 

 

4、Xpath中常用的函数

 

 参照xpath函数手册

 

4、Chrome开发者工具校验Xpath、css

Elements面板,Ctrl + F

$x("some_xpath") or $$("css-selectors")

 

posted @ 2021-08-10 20:47  我是大脸猫H  阅读(636)  评论(0编辑  收藏  举报